5V per USB ok, 12V per Netzteil nicht ok.

Hallo,

wenn ich meinen Arduino Uno am PC stecken habe und teste läuft alles glatt. LEDs blinken, Servos drehen ihre halben Runden, etc.

Versuche ich aber abseits des PCs den Arduino mit einem Netzteil (12V mit 1000mA) zu betreiben, quittiert er schon im Setup() seinen Dienst.
Stecke ich nun aber ganz dreist das 5V-Handy-Netzteil meiner Freundin an den USB-Port blinken die LEDs und die Servos tanzen vor sich hin.

Mein Setting: eine LED auf Pin13 und zwei 3-Pin-Servos an Pin7+8. Strom für die Servos hole ich über den 5V-Pin. (VIN nehme ich nicht, da ich nicht weiß ob die Servos 12V vertragen...)

Was ist da los? Laut http://arduino.cc/de/Main/ArduinoBoardUno sollte ich doch sogar mit 20V arbeiten können. Kann mir das jemand erklären?

Grüße

Ist die Polung des Steckers vom Netzteil korrekt, sprich innen plus außen minus?

Hallo,

der Spannungsregler, der die 12V nach 5V auf dem Arduino umsetzt, ist bei deinen Lasten (Motoren) hoffnungslos überfordert, da 7V mal gezogener Strom verheizt wird! Für ein paar wenige LEDs langts :wink:

Gruß Gerald

Deine Servos brauchen zu viel Strom.

der USB_Port schafft das anscheinend, (was auch ungewöhnlich ist), der Arduino 5V-Regler nicht.
du mußt die Servos extern versorgen. (und, ja, 12v verkraften Servos nicht. Die meisten können noch 6V, mehr aber nicht)

Strom für die Servos hole ich über den 5V-Pin.

Wie gesagt ist das dein Problem. (wobwi ich mich aber auch wundere wieso es Dir über USB funktioniert).
Grüße Uwe

Oder Netzteil brummt. Mach mal nen Elko parallel.

Super, vielen Dank für die vielen Antworten.

Es liegt also am fehlenden Strom. Das ist schon mal gut zu wissen und ich werde mich um externe Stromquellen bemühen.